diff options
author | Lioncash <mathew1800@gmail.com> | 2019-05-19 18:47:30 +0200 |
---|---|---|
committer | Lioncash <mathew1800@gmail.com> | 2019-05-19 18:47:33 +0200 |
commit | 17255cd835a4727ab83fd2bfa1b4d21a98a19f61 (patch) | |
tree | 2ea09e229916d040b37d4867e8ad06b67f41c16f | |
parent | yuzu/configuration/configure_mouse_advanced: Clean up array accesses (diff) | |
download | yuzu-17255cd835a4727ab83fd2bfa1b4d21a98a19f61.tar yuzu-17255cd835a4727ab83fd2bfa1b4d21a98a19f61.tar.gz yuzu-17255cd835a4727ab83fd2bfa1b4d21a98a19f61.tar.bz2 yuzu-17255cd835a4727ab83fd2bfa1b4d21a98a19f61.tar.lz yuzu-17255cd835a4727ab83fd2bfa1b4d21a98a19f61.tar.xz yuzu-17255cd835a4727ab83fd2bfa1b4d21a98a19f61.tar.zst yuzu-17255cd835a4727ab83fd2bfa1b4d21a98a19f61.zip |
-rw-r--r-- | src/yuzu/configuration/configure_per_general.cpp | 14 |
1 files changed, 8 insertions, 6 deletions
diff --git a/src/yuzu/configuration/configure_per_general.cpp b/src/yuzu/configuration/configure_per_general.cpp index 022b94609..2bdfc8e5a 100644 --- a/src/yuzu/configuration/configure_per_general.cpp +++ b/src/yuzu/configuration/configure_per_general.cpp @@ -88,15 +88,15 @@ void ConfigurePerGameGeneral::loadFromFile(FileSys::VirtualFile file) { } void ConfigurePerGameGeneral::loadConfiguration() { - if (file == nullptr) + if (file == nullptr) { return; + } - const auto loader = Loader::GetLoader(file); - - ui->display_title_id->setText(fmt::format("{:016X}", title_id).c_str()); + ui->display_title_id->setText(QString::fromStdString(fmt::format("{:016X}", title_id))); FileSys::PatchManager pm{title_id}; const auto control = pm.GetControlMetadata(); + const auto loader = Loader::GetLoader(file); if (control.first != nullptr) { ui->display_version->setText(QString::fromStdString(control.first->GetVersionString())); @@ -142,8 +142,10 @@ void ConfigurePerGameGeneral::loadConfiguration() { const auto& disabled = Settings::values.disabled_addons[title_id]; for (const auto& patch : pm.GetPatchVersionNames(update_raw)) { - QStandardItem* first_item = new QStandardItem; - const auto name = QString::fromStdString(patch.first).replace("[D] ", ""); + const auto name = + QString::fromStdString(patch.first).replace(QStringLiteral("[D] "), QString{}); + + auto* const first_item = new QStandardItem; first_item->setText(name); first_item->setCheckable(true); |